31、the white house,(白色的房子),tall boy,高个男孩,the White House,(美国的白宫),hotdog,(热狗面包夹熏红肠),an English teacher,(一位英国籍的老师),hot dog,(发怒的狗),an English teacher,(一位英语教师),_,_,_,_,_,_,_,_,_,_,Besides listening for the main idea,it is also important to identify important details.What counts as an important detail vari

32、es with the text.For example,in narration,(,叙述文,),one should pay attention to words answering“who,what,when,where,why and how”questions.In an argumentation,(,议论文,),one should focus on the evidence leading to the main thesis(such as“from what we can see”,“as the data shows”,“we can safely say if we t

33、akeinto consideration”,and“there is a strong connection between”),and the speakers attitude,usually realized through modal,(,情态动词,),expressions and adjectives(such as“it should be pointed out”,“it is clear”,“it is without doubt”,and“we ought to”).In exposition,(,说明文,),one should take heed,(,注意,),of

34、words that lead to the process of doing and explaining(such as“first”,“second”,“next”,and“finally”).,Listening SkillListen for,Important,Details,Unit 2 Part II Section II,Rule of Thumb 1,Write down words that will help explain who,what,when,where,why and how in the listening materials.,Rule of Thumb
